If a number is multiplied by itself, the result is a square. The inverse of the square is a square root. The square root is used in various fields such as vehicle design, finance, etc. Here, we will discuss the square root of 0.0625.

Professor Greenline from BrightChamps

What is the Square Root of 0.0625?

The square root is the inverse of the square of the number. 0.0625 is a perfect square. The square root of 0.0625 is expressed in both radical and exponential form. In the radical form, it is expressed as √0.0625, whereas (0.0625)(1/2) in the exponential form. √0.0625 = 0.25, which is a rational number because it can be expressed in the form of p/q, where p and q are integers and q ≠ 0.

Finding the Square Root of 0.0625

For perfect square numbers, the prime factorization method is often used. However, since 0.0625 is a decimal, we can simply convert it to a fraction and find its square root directly. Let us now learn the following methods:

 

  • Fraction conversion method
  • Direct calculation method
Professor Greenline from BrightChamps

Square Root of 0.0625 by Fraction Conversion Method

The fraction conversion method involves expressing the decimal as a fraction and then finding its square root.

 

Step 1: Convert 0.0625 to a fraction 0.0625 = 625/10000 = (25/100)2

 

Step 2: Find the square root of the fraction √(625/10000) = √(252/1002) = 25/100 = 0.25

 

Thus, the square root of 0.0625 is 0.25.

Professor Greenline from BrightChamps

Square Root of 0.0625 by Direct Calculation Method

The direct calculation method involves finding the square root of the decimal directly, as it is a straightforward calculation for perfect squares.

 

Step 1: Identify 0.0625 as a perfect square 0.0625 = (0.25)2

 

Step 2: Directly calculate the square root √0.0625 = 0.25

 

Thus, the square root of 0.0625 is 0.25.

Important Glossaries for the Square Root of 0.0625

  • Square root: The square root is the inverse operation of squaring a number. Example: For 42 = 16, the square root is √16 = 4.
     
  • Rational number: A rational number is a number that can be expressed as a fraction where both the numerator and the denominator are integers and the denominator is not zero. 
     
  • Decimal: A decimal is a number that includes a decimal point, representing a fraction of a whole. For example, 0.25 represents 25/100.
     
  • Perfect square: A perfect square is a number that is the square of an integer or a rational number. Example: 0.0625 is a perfect square because it equals (0.25)2.
     
  • Fraction: A fraction is a way to represent numbers by dividing one integer by another. Example: 0.0625 can be expressed as 625/10000.
